A Dormant Heart

A Dormant Heart

A Poem by Audrey Howitt
"

A poem about middle aged lovers

"

Soften my hard edges

Those that my life has seen fit

To impose upon the veneer of my persona.

Let me lose myself in your smell,

So like that of a meadow after rain’s fall.

Kindle the fire which dormant lies,

Tarnished by daily frustrations.

Lie with me, sweet lover of my soul,

And like the moth,

Let us play with fire.

© 2011 Audrey Howitt
